One Morning She Woke Up Different

One morning she woke up different. Done with trying to figure out who was with her, against her, or walking down the middle because they didn’t have the guts to pick a side. She was done with anything that didn’t bring her peace.

She realized that opinions were a dime a dozen, validation was for parking, and loyalty wasn’t a word but a lifestyle.

It was this day that her life changed. And not because of a man or a job but because she realized that life is way too short to leave the key to your happiness in someone else’s pocket. — unknown
